## Tuning

Tracing in Quillgate propagates span context via the `qg-trace` header across all services. Sampling is head-based; the collector drops anything over budget. If traces vanish during incident triage, raise the sample rate temporarily and revert after. Don't touch the export batch size without paging the Lanternview platform team first. Current defaults are listed below.

tuning constants:
QUOTAS = {
    "druwyn": 5,
    "holix": 5,
    "zorath": 5,
    "holwyn": 10,
}

Subject: Payroll export cut-over complete

Team — the Ledgerline payroll export cut-over finished last night. All tenants now emit the v4 column layout; the legacy fixed-width format is retired. Expect tickets from customers with old import scripts — point them to the v4 mapping doc. Re-exports of pre-cut-over periods still come out in v4. Escalate parsing failures to the payroll squad. The exporter now runs with the following settings.

config for tajep-yawip:
druwyn:
  log_level: warn
  metrics_host: metrics.druwyn.tolvaqsys.internal
  pin: 7194
  pool_size: 8

- [ ] **Step 7: Breaker override escrow.** After sealing the signing keys for the Tallgrove upstream API circuit breaker, confirm the support team can force the breaker open during a full outage. The override bundle lives in the sealed escrow drawer and is useless without its unlock phrase. Two ceremony witnesses must initial this step before proceeding. The escrow bundle is decrypted with the recovery passphrase that follows.

vault phrase of kahip-kahop = holath-quenmir

## Idempotency Keys for Payment Retries (Lumopay)

Every retry of a charge request must reuse the original idempotency key; generating a new key on retry can produce duplicate charges. Keys are scoped per merchant and expire after 48 hours. Reviewers should verify keys are derived server-side, never from client input. The full key-generation specification and threat model are maintained on the internal page.

dashboard of kaguf-tawip = https://vault.merlaqsys.test/issue